This is how my design wall looks today with two rows sewn together and another sashing row ready to join.
The cornerstones blocks aren't finished yet because I made a miscalculation on the size.
I didn't like my first version, which as you can see, had a too large strip around a too small center square, and resulted in a sashing size that was too large. I am cutting down the ones I have sewn and am much happier with how they look in the two rows that are sewn together. The dotty light sashing fabric is just perfect and the whole project cheers me up every time I have a chance to sew a little more on it.
